Saturday is a normal working day there with trucks everywhere, so best to stay away. Sundays and holidays are clear.

K
 
ditto. i rode there on Saturday once for one lap and went elsewhere. There will be trucks parked in left lane (everywhere) and fast moving truck traffic in second and third lanes. dodging passenger cars/minivans/small trucks on koshu kaido is one thing, but dodging Japan's equivalent of 18 wheelers is quite another.
